2.5 Preparation of N-(2-(2-(2-(2-azidoethoxy) ethoxy) ethoxy) ethyl)-5-(2-oxohexahydro-1H-thieno[3,4-d]imidazol-4-yl) pentanamide (Biotin-N3, (6))

Biotin-OSuc (14) (187 mg, 0.55 mmol) was completely dissolved in DMF (5 mL) with gentle warming.
After slowly cooling the solution to room temperature without recurring precipitation, the 11-azido-3,6,9-trioxaundecan-1-amine (
Borcard et al., 2011
) (109 mg, 0.50 mmol) was added.
The reaction proceeded at room temperature overnight with stirring and the reaction products were concentrated under vacuum.
The remaining solid was triturated in CH2Cl2/Et2O (30/70) solution and the white solid was filtered to obtain N-(2-(2-(2-(2-azidoethoxy) ethoxy) ethoxy) ethyl)-5-(2-oxohexahydro-1H-thieno[3,4-d]imidazol-4-yl) pentanamide (6) (219 mg; quant.); 1H NMR (300 MHz, DMSO-d6): δ 6.43-6.38 (s, 1H, NH), 6.37-6.34 (s, 1H, NH), 4.33-4.25 (m, 1H), 4.12-4.09 (m, 1H), 3.62-3.34 (m, 12H), 3.12-3.08 (m, 1H), 2.89-2.78 (m, 4H), 1.55-1.19 (m, 6H); 13C NMR (100 MHz, CDCl3): δ 25.6, 28.0, 28.1, 35.9, 39.2, 40.5, 50.7, 55.5, 60.3, 61.8, 70.0, 70.1, 70.4, 70.5, 70.6, 163.9, 173.5; LRMS (ESI) m/z calcd for C18H32N6O5SH+ 445.2; found 445.2.

References:

Salomé, Christophe;Spanedda, Maria Vittoria;Hilbold, Benoit;Berner, Etienne;Heurtault, Béatrice;Fournel, Sylvie;Frisch, Benoit;Bourel-Bonnet, Line [Chemistry and Physics of Lipids,2015,vol. 188,art. no. 4354,p. 27 - 36]
